Strange issue with my new RAID setup. Hardware wise everything works. The bios setup the RAID correctly and Windows installed fine. But here is the problem... Windows keeps wanting to install the "NVRAID Class Device Setup" but errors out since "Name is already in use as either a service name or service display name".

Looking at it closer the driver is already installed and working fine. Everything in Windows works great. But it keeps telling me it can't install the device because its already there. Well duh Windows you can't install two drivers for the same device. Its strange since you don't see Windows asking to install something that already installed very often. So two drives in RAID work fine but the hardware detection in Windows is not working correctly.

My question... Has anyone seen this before? Whats the fix? or What would you try to fix it?

I'm on a NForce 4 using the onboard controller using Strip.
 
Are the nVidia RAID drivers slipstreamed into Windows XP?

What version of drivers are you using?
 
When I installed windows XP I installed just the drivers on the floppy that came with the motherboard. After I got into Windows and started having this problem I upgraded to the newest drivers online.
